MAS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

627 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Masco (MAS)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$10.3B — down 0.77% from $10.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 88 funds opened new MAS positions and 72 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 215 added to existing stakes and 231 trimmed.

The largest buyer was AQR Capital Management, adding an estimated $171M. The largest seller was Amundi Asset Management US, cutting an estimated $148M.
